Cottage of Joan of Arc House

An authentic holiday home to live with family or friends. Comfortably equipped, it is located in the countryside on the edge of the Indre. For a weekend, several days or for a week, an ideal formula for a pleasant holiday. 

20 km from Chinon and 25 km from Tours, close to all shops and near the castles of the Loire and vineyards of Touraine,
Typical house completely renovated with exposed beams and stones, you can enjoy the garden overlooking the river.
Ideal and central location for a tour of the region and its riches: castles, gardens, troglodytes, museums, vineyards, the "Loire by bike", "Indre by bike" ...

Description:
Gîte of independent character.
Capacity of 2 or 4 beds.

Characteristics :

R d c:
Living room, with sofa bed.
Fully equipped kitchen (dishwasher, hotplates, oven, microwave, coffee maker, fridge freezer)

Floor:
Bedroom, bathroom with shower, toilet, washing machine and dryer.
No pets allowed on the floor

Electric heating.

Large garden of 2500m² on the edge of the Indre (garden furniture, charcoal barbecue).
Ideal fishing (sports cafe fishing map - Azay-le-rideau, bakery - Rivarennes, Café - Lignères-de-touraine)

Prices :
Off season from September to June:
At night: 70 euros

High season July and August:
At night: 80 euros

Options:
Cleaning charge: 30 euros
Animal: 1 euros / day / animal
